The Republic of the Marshall Islands consists of two chains of 29 coral atolls and five low islands stretching several hundred miles from north to south with a total land area of 70 square miles and a population of 73,630 (est. 2002). The republic, formerly a Trust Territory, entered into a Compact of Free Association with the United States in October 1986. One mainstay of the economy is the U.S. space tracking station on Kwajalein, but the Marshalls are also developing their agriculture and marine resources.
